Title in English
Evaluation of in vitro antimicrobial effect of chitosan and chitosan/chlorhexidine on saliva and Streptococcus mutans

Abstract in English
Saliva and Streptococcus mutans were used to evaluate antimicrobial activity of chitosan/chlorexidine solutions. Antimicrobial tests were conducted using chitosan and chitosan/ chlorexidine solutions in 1.0 % acetic acid solution, at various pH values (3.5-5.0) and concentrations ranging from 0.1 to 1.5% (w/v). Prior to each experiment, chitosan (DA 76%, 400.000 g/mol) stock solution pH was adjusted to the desired pH using NaOH. The antimicrobial activity increased with pH, concentration, exposition time and with the association of chitosan and chlorexidine. Increasing the concentration of chlorexidine did not have a significant effect indicating that in presence of chitosan it is possible to deliver this compound at a lower concentration which will avoid unwanted side effects including staining and altered taste sensations
